Jeffrey A. Conn has been
active in the real estate industry since 1972.
He is a cofounder of Hallmark Partners, formed in 1993. He is
directly responsible for all aspects of the company’s business
including development, leasing and property management.
He was first employed
for sixteen years with Alliance Mortgage Company, a Florida based,
statewide mortgage banking firm.
During his tenure, he spent the first twelve years in south
Florida, focusing on new loan originations and the subsequent
remaining four years directing the company’s commercial production
division headquartered in Jacksonville.
He is a licensed
Mortgage Broker and Real Estate Broker in the state of Florida.
He is a past President of the Jacksonville Chapter of NAIOP,
the National Association of Industrial and Office Properties.
He is also a member of the Commercial Development Task Force
and the Industrial Task Force of the Jacksonville Chamber of Commerce.
He is a member of the Advisory Board for the Center for Real
Estate Studies at the University of Florida in Gainesville.
He sits on the Board of Directors of the Otis Smith Foundation,
a charitable organization that focuses on underprivileged children in
the Jacksonville area.
